Speaking of Bees I get board that the only bees we see in media are Honeybees or Bumble Bees. Show me a anthro Digging Bee or an Mason Bee in a cartoon or something. Anything to show the public that bees aren't just Yellow.
I agree! I always get very excited when a piece of media has a bug in it that isn't one of the five or six species that get referenced and represented over and over and over- More bees that aren't honey bees! More wasps that aren't eusocial vespids! More beetles that aren't ladybugs or stags! Etc etc etc.
I understand the fact that only a select number of species or families will be truly culturally iconic among hundreds of thousands of species but only representing a select few species is what leads to things like the Save The Bees campaign getting boiled down to the point people go and introduce honey bees to even more places they have no business being in over native bee populations.

The concerted effort of maintaining application resilience
New Post has been published on https://thedigitalinsider.com/the-concerted-effort-of-maintaining-application-resilience/
The concerted effort of maintaining application resilience
Back when most business applications were monolithic, ensuring their resilience was by no means easy. But given the way apps run in 2025 and what’s expected of them, maintaining monolithic apps was arguably simpler.
Back then, IT staff had a finite set of criteria on which to improve an application’s resilience, and the rate of change to the application and its infrastructure was a great deal slower. Today, the demands we place on apps are different, more numerous, and subject to a faster rate of change.
There are also just more applications. According to IDC, there are likely to be a billion more in production by 2028 – and many of these will be running on cloud-native code and mixed infrastructure. With technological complexity and higher service expectations of responsiveness and quality, ensuring resilience has grown into being a massively more complex ask.
Multi-dimensional elements determine app resilience, dimensions that fall into different areas of responsibility in the modern enterprise: Code quality falls to development teams; infrastructure might be down to systems administrators or DevOps; compliance and data governance officers have their own needs and stipulations, as do cybersecurity professionals, storage engineers, database administrators, and a dozen more besides.
With multiple tools designed to ensure the resilience of an app – with definitions of what constitutes resilience depending on who’s asking – it’s small wonder that there are typically dozens of tools that work to improve and maintain resilience in play at any one time in the modern enterprise.
Determining resilience across the whole enterprise’s portfolio, therefore, is near-impossible. Monitoring software is silo-ed, and there’s no single pane of reference.
IBM’s Concert Resilience Posture simplifies the complexities of multiple dashboards, normalizes the different quality judgments, breaks down data from different silos, and unifies the disparate purposes of monitoring and remediation tools in play.
Speaking ahead of TechEx North America (4-5 June, Santa Clara Convention Center), Jennifer Fitzgerald, Product Management Director, Observability, at IBM, took us through the Concert Resilience Posture solution, its aims, and its ethos. On the latter, she differentiates it from other tools:
“Everything we’re doing is grounded in applications – the health and performance of the applications and reducing risk factors for the application.”
The app-centric approach means the bringing together of the different metrics in the context of desired business outcomes, answering questions that matter to an organization’s stakeholders, like:
Will every application scale?
What effects have code changes had?
Are we over- or under-resourcing any element of any application?
Is infrastructure supporting or hindering application deployment?
Are we safe and in line with data governance policies?
What experience are we giving our customers?
Jennifer says IBM Concert Resilience Posture is, “a new way to think about resilience – to move it from a manual stitching [of other tools] or a ton of different dashboards.” Although the definition of resilience can be ephemeral, according to which criteria are in play, Jennifer says it’s comprised, at its core, of eight non-functional requirements (NFRs):
Observability
Availability
Maintainability
Recoverability
Scalability
Usability
Integrity
Security
NFRs are important everywhere in the organization, and there are perhaps only two or three that are the sole remit of one department – security falls to the CISO, for example. But ensuring the best quality of resilience in all of the above is critically important right across the enterprise. It’s a shared responsibility for maintaining excellence in performance, potential, and safety.
What IBM Concert Resilience Posture gives organizations, different from what’s offered by a collection of disparate tools and beyond the single-pane-of-glass paradigm, is proactivity. Proactive resilience comes from its ability to give a resilience score, based on multiple metrics, with a score determined by the many dozens of data points in each NFR. Companies can see their overall or per-app scores drift as changes are made – to the infrastructure, to code, to the portfolio of applications in production, and so on.
“The thought around resilience is that we as humans aren’t perfect. We’re going to make mistakes. But how do you come back? You want your applications to be fully, highly performant, always optimal, with the required uptime. But issues are going to happen. A code change is introduced that breaks something, or there’s more demand on a certain area that slows down performance. And so the application resilience we’re looking at is all around the ability of systems to withstand and recover quickly from disruptions, failures, spikes in demand, [and] unexpected events,” she says.
IBM’s acquisition history points to some of the complimentary elements of the Concert Resilience Posture solution – Instana for full-stack observability, Turbonomic for resource optimization, for example. But the whole is greater than the sum of the parts. There’s an AI-powered continuous assessment of all elements that make up an organization’s resilience, so there’s one place where decision-makers and IT teams can assess, manage, and configure the full-stack’s resilience profile.
The IBM portfolio of resilience-focused solutions helps teams see when and why loads change and therefore where resources are wasted. It’s possible to ensure that necessary resources are allocated only when needed, and systems automatically scale back when they’re not. That sort of business- and cost-centric capability is at the heart of app-centric resilience, and means that a company is always optimizing its resources.
Overarching all aspects of app performance and resilience is the element of cost. Throwing extra resources at an under-performing application (or its supporting infrastructure) isn’t a viable solution in most organizations. With IBM, organizations get the ability to scale and grow, to add or iterate apps safely, without necessarily having to invest in new provisioning, either in the cloud or on-premise. Plus, they can see how any changes impact resilience. It’s making best use of what’s available, and winning back capacity – all while getting the best performance, responsiveness, reliability, and uptime across the enterprise’s application portfolio.
Jennifer says, “There’s a lot of different things that can impact resilience and that’s why it’s been so difficult to measure. An application has so many different layers underneath, even in just its resources and how it’s built. But then there’s the spider web of downstream impacts. A code change could impact multiple apps, or it could impact one piece of an app. What is the downstream impact of something going wrong? And that’s a big piece of what our tools are helping organizations with.”

When Not to Use Flutter: A Complete List of Cases
Tumblr media
In the field of mobile app development, Flutter is rapidly taking off. It has drawn the interest of developers and companies alike because of its reputation for producing aesthetically pleasing and highly functioning apps across various platforms. But is it the answer to every problem with mobile apps? This all-inclusive guide seeks to answer that query.
In addition to delving into the settings where Flutter excels, this article examines the shadows where it might not be the best option. Flutter is no exception regarding the idea that a single development framework might be a one-size-fits-all solution. Advantages and drawbacks are also present. When navigating these considerations, hire Flutter app developer who can strategically leverage the framework’s strengths and mitigate potential limitations for optimal application development becomes crucial.
Flutter’s Drawbacks and When Not to Use It
Though Flutter has many benefits, there are several situations in which there might be better options. Understanding its limitations will help you make the best choice possible for your project.
1. Restrictions on the platform
Wearables devices: While developing apps for wearables, especially for Apple Watch, you might not be able to utilize the speed and functionality of Flutter fully. Android TV and Smart TV: Development apps for these platforms requires an in-depth rethinking of control logic. Android TV is mainly controlled by remote control input, while Flutter is designed to work with touchscreens and mouse clicks. The difference leads to more excellent development times and maybe inconsistent user experiences. Play Market with instant apps: Instant apps must have rapid reactions. Even with optimization, the inherent size of Flutter apps frequently exceeds that of native apps. Google has established a strict 10MB limit, so Flutter apps with many features or packages may find it challenging to stay under this limit.
2. Size Consideration
Size constraints may be a concern when considering Flutter. Flutter apps can have a larger file size than native applications, impacting download and installation times, especially in regions with slower internet connections. Additionally, if the app requires minimalistic functionality or specific platform-native features, the overhead introduced by Flutter might outweigh its benefits. In such cases, opting for platform-specific development could be more efficient. To navigate size considerations and ensure optimal outcomes, hiring a skilled Flutter app development team becomes essential for strategic decision-making and efficient utilization of the framework’s capabilities.
3. Connectivity and technical issues Bluetooth connection issues: There are occasionally several issues while utilizing Flutter to connect to hardware via Bluetooth. Developers may experience issues with connectivity and performance as Flutter does not directly use the device’s native Bluetooth capabilities. Compared with native frameworks, it makes the app development process more complex but still accessible.
Challenges for web development: Although Flutter for Web created a lot of excitement, a few things could be improved with SEO and loading performance. Furthermore, programmers who want to develop complex web experiences may need help. 
Flutter’s restricted WebView supports different new system features: As operating systems develop, new features are added that application developers can take advantage of. Compared to native SDK alternatives, Flutter’s cycle for implementing these capabilities is noticeably slower. One example is that after the release of iOS 13, which enabled dark mode, it took more than two years for the half-baked launch of the Dark Mode for iOS in Flutter. In the same way, Flutter has yet to provide performance on pace with the 120+ Hz screens found on modern smartphones.
Using Native code: Kotlin or Swift are examples of native languages that must be used to recreate some native UI elements in Flutter. For instance, Flutter implementations of video players may look different from system ones, particularly on iOS.
4. Increased Development Costs
The cost of Flutter development tends to be higher than that of Native development. This is because creating cross-platform applications with a unified look and feel requires particular knowledge and is challenging. It can also be difficult to find senior Flutter developers. Although the community is expanding, it is still relatively fresh, and as a result, experienced professionals in this field are in high demand, which may result in higher prices.
Suitable Applications for Flutter Development
Flutter’s strengths make it particularly well-suited for developing the following types of mobile applications:
1. E-commerce Apps: Flutter’s ability to create visually appealing and performant interfaces makes it ideal for building e-commerce apps that provide a seamless shopping experience for users.
2. Social Media Apps: Flutter’s cross-platform capabilities and declarative UI framework are well-suited for developing engaging social media apps that connect users across various devices.
3. Gaming Apps: Flutter’s high-performance rendering and cross-platform compatibility make it a viable choice for building casual and mid-core games that can run smoothly on a wide range of devices.
4. Educational Apps: Flutter’s declarative UI and interactive capabilities are ideal for creating engaging educational apps that provide a rich learning experience for users.
5. Productivity Apps: Flutter’s efficient development process and ability to create intuitive interfaces make it suitable for building productivity apps that streamline users’ tasks and workflows.
Thus, Flutter’s strengths in cross-platform development, high performance, declarative UI, and a rich ecosystem make it a compelling choice for building a diverse range of modern mobile applications.
Why Flutter is a Good Choice for Mobile App Development?
Flutter is a fantastic option for developing mobile apps for the following reasons: Fast development: Flutter is a framework that enables developers to write code for both iOS and Android platforms using a single codebase. This can significantly reduce the development time and cost of mobile apps. High performance: Flutter apps are compiled into native code, meaning they can run as fast as native apps. This contrasts with other cross-platform frameworks like React Native, which can have performance issues. Rich UI: Flutter provides a wide range of widgets and tools for creating rich and engaging user interfaces. This makes it a good choice for developing apps that must be visually appealing and easy to use. Hot reload: Flutter’s desirable reload feature allows developers to see changes to their code reflected in the app without restarting it. Flutter’s hot reload capability streamlines the development process, saving valuable time and effort for developers. Large community: Flutter boasts a vibrant and thriving community of developers, fostering collaboration, knowledge sharing, and continuous framework improvement. This means that a wealth of resources is available to help developers learn and use the framework. Google support: Google supports Flutter, meaning it is a stable and reliable framework. This is important for businesses that need to develop apps that many users will use. Open-source: Flutter is an open-source framework that is free to use and modify. This makes it a good choice for businesses wanting more control over their development process. Hence, Flutter is a good choice for mobile app development because it is fast, performant, and has a rich UI. It is also a good choice for businesses that need to develop apps that many users will use.
